## Resizer CLI — maintainer notes

The `pixshrink` CLI handles batch image resizing for the Cardwell asset pipeline. Jobs are chunked at 500 images and pushed to the Renderhive queue. Config lives in `pixshrink.toml`; avoid changing concurrency without load testing. Queue submissions authenticate against the internal Renderhive endpoint using the key below.

service key, fawip-bajef: kto11_Qt5wZK9vdNC

**Ticket CRSH-PIPE: Vault locked, can't rotate signing cert**

Hey all — the Glimmerfall crash-report pipeline stopped ingesting mobile dumps overnight. Turns out the symbolication vault auto-locked after the host reboot, so nothing can decrypt incoming reports. New folks: this happens occasionally, don't panic. Grab someone from the tooling rotation, open the vault console from the staging bastion, and unseal it. The unseal step asks for the recovery passphrase below.

unlock words, hahip-baduf: holwyn-istath-julvan

Subject: Pool sizing change in Harborline 2.9 — please review before cut

Hi Renata,

Harborline 2.9 changes the database connection pool from a fixed 50 connections to an adaptive range of 10–80, scaling on checkout wait time. This prevents idle connections from exhausting the primary during quiet hours while still absorbing the morning batch spike. We also lowered the idle timeout to 90 seconds and added pool-exhaustion metrics. Staging soak ran clean for five days. The candidate build is identified below.

trace token, fafog-kageg: htk4_98e6